If there’s one good thing bodyboarders have done for surfing it’s proving the ability of paddle into big waves. Here’s Tom Low and Fergal Smith break boundaries in 2011 and scrap into waves previously thought impossible. This is the story of the dawn of paddle in Ireland, and the speculation on where it may lead. Ireland’s a consistent freezing of the senses. It’s okay to be fearful.
